MHIRJ Expands MRO Network with New Facility in Macon, Georgia, Solidifying Its Position as the Largest Regional MRO in the World

The new facility will be located at the Middle Georgia Regional Airport and is part of MHIRJ's growing footprint in North America servicing the CRJ Series fleet.

- With facilities in Macon, Georgia; Bridgeport, West Virginia and Tucson, Arizona, MHIRJ is the world's largest Regional MRO.
- "We are excited about this addition to our Service Center network as it confirms MHIRJ's position as the largest Regional MRO in the world and it allows us to provide better service for our customers," said Hiro Yamamoto, President and CEO of MHIRJ.
- "It's a great day in Macon-Bibb County to welcome MHIRJ to the Middle Georgia Regional Airport," says Macon-Bibb County Mayor Lester Miller.
